Process Management

#include "stdafx.h"
#include <iostream>
using namespace std;

class Process
{
private:
      int state, pid;
public:
      Process()
      {
            state=0;
            pid=100;
      }
      Process(int s, int p):state(s),pid(p){}
      void New()
      {
            state=0;
            cout<<"Process is in state: "<<state;
            cout<<"Process is being created \n resource are being initialized \n";
            for(int i=0; i<100; i++)
                  cout<<".";
            cout<<"Process is created and about to load\n";
            ready();
      }
      void ready()
      {
            state=1;
            cout<<"Process is in state: "<<state;
            cout<<"Process is in main memory and waiting for cpu \n";
            for(int i=0; i<100; i++)
                  cout<<".";
            cout<<"\n Process is about to dispatch \n";
            running();
      }
      void running()
      {
            state=2;
            cout<<"Process is in state: "<<state;
            cout<<"Process is in cpu and instruction are being executed \n";
            for(int i=0; i<100; i++)
                  cout<<".";
            char choice;
            cout<<"\n Press i for interupt, w for waiting, and t for termination \n";
            cin>>choice;
            switch (choice)
            {
            case'i':
                  cout<<"Process is interupted \n";
                  ready();
                  break;
            case'w':
                  cout<<"Process need I/O or event \n";
                  waiting();
                  break;
            case't':
                  cout<<"Process is about to finish \n";
                  terminate();
                  break;
            default:
                  cout<<"Wrong choice \n";
                  terminate();
            }
      }
      void waiting()
      {
            state=3;
            cout<<"Process is in state: "<<state;
            cout<<"Process is in waiting queue and needs service \n";
            for(int i=0; i<100; i++)
                  cout<<".";
            cout<<"\n Process is serviced \n";
            ready();
      }
      void terminate()
      {
            state=4;
            cout<<"Process is in state: "<<state;
            cout<<"\n Resoyrce are being deallocated \n";
            for(int i=0; i<100; i++)
                  cout<<".";
            cout<<"\n Process terminated Successfully \n";
      }
};

int _tmain(int argc, _TCHAR* argv[])
{
      Process myprocess;
      myprocess.New();
      return 0;
}
